WebA mortgage lien is a prime example of a voluntary lien. On the other hand, an involuntary lien originates from the operation of law. Hence, it is often called a statutory lien. An example is a property tax lien. Unlike a voluntary lien, involuntary liens does not require the property owner's consent to be attached. WebMar 26, 2016 · Tax lien: A tax lien is placed on real estate for unpaid real estate taxes. Remember the government organization is paid first. Different levels of government from cities, towns, and counties can place tax liens on property. Tax liens are involuntary and specific. Mortgage lien: A mortgage lien is a voluntary, specific lien. WebDec 17, 2024 · Involuntary Lien: An involuntary lien may attach to a property without the consent of the homeowner. An example of an involuntary lien would be a municipal lien. In Florida, municipal liens are typically unrecorded and are imposed pursuant to Chapters 159 and 170, Florida Statutes.
